Plumbing Myths You Should Know About

Plumbing is something most homeowners don’t pay too much attention to and therefore don’t have much knowledge of. This makes it easy to believe any information put out there. In this post, we share with you the top plumbing myths that you most definitely should know about.

Myth #1: Use lemon peels in the garbage disposal to improve smell

While it is true that the lemon peel will make it smell nice, the peel itself poses the risk of blockage and the acid within the peel might corrode and damage your disposal and the piping. For a safer option, try using ice blocks, white vinegar and lots of water to flush out smells.

Myth #2: You can flush “flushable wipes” down the toilet

The truth is, flushable wipes are causing many clogging issues. They don’t dissolve the same way that toilet paper does. Save yourself any unnecessary problems and costs by keeping a habit of only flushing toilet paper and human waste.

Myth #3: You don’t need to worry about getting your leaky faucet fixed

You might have heard that you don’t need to worry too much about that faucet in your home that is occasionally dripping or that you should simply tighten the tap to fix the issue. If you ignore your leaky faucets, you are setting yourself up to lose money in the long run. Dripping faucets account for a lot of wasted water and the dripping can wear out the faucet leading to more money you need to spend to repair it in the future.

Myth #4: You can put grease down your drain if you mix it with boiling water

Grease does not belong down your drains and accounts for majority of kitchen drain blockage issues. As grease cools down, it hardens and solidifies. If you pour it down your drain hot, it will cling to the drain walls, harden and build up over time.
